/*
 * flood.c: puzzle in which you make a grid all the same colour by
 * repeatedly flood-filling the top left corner, and try to do so in
 * as few moves as possible.
 */

/*
 * Possible further work:
 *
 *  - UI: perhaps we should only permit clicking on regions that can
 *    actually be reached by the next flood-fill - i.e. a click is
 *    only interpreted as a move if it would cause the clicked-on
 *    square to become part of the controlled area. This provides a
 *    hint in cases where you mistakenly thought that would happen,
 *    and protects you against typos in cases where you just
 *    mis-aimed.
 *
 *  - UI: perhaps mark the fill square in some way? Or even mark the
 *    whole connected component _containing_ the fill square. Pro:
 *    that would make it easier to tell apart cases where almost all
 *    the yellow squares in the grid are part of the target component
 *    (hence, yellow is _done_ and you never have to fill in that
 *    colour again) from cases where there's still one yellow square
 *    that's only diagonally adjacent and hence will need coming back
 *    to. Con: but it would almost certainly be ugly.
 */

/*
 * Search a grid to find the most distant square(s). Return their
 * distance and the number of them, and also the number of squares in
 * the current controlled set (i.e. at distance zero).
 */
static void search(int w, int h, char *grid, int x0, int y0,
                   struct solver_scratch *scratch,
                   int *rdist, int *rnumber, int *rcontrol)
{
    int wh = w*h;
    int i, qcurr, qhead, qtail, qnext, currdist, remaining;

    for (i = 0; i < wh; i++)
        scratch->dist[i] = -1;
    scratch->queue[0][0] = y0*w+x0;
    scratch->queue[1][0] = y0*w+x0;
    scratch->dist[y0*w+x0] = 0;
    currdist = 0;
    qcurr = 0;
    qtail = 0;
    qhead = 1;
    qnext = 1;
    remaining = wh - 1;

    while (1) {
        if (qtail == qhead) {
            /* Switch queues. */
            if (currdist == 0)
                *rcontrol = qhead;
            currdist++;
            qcurr ^= 1;                    /* switch queues */
            qhead = qnext;
            qtail = 0;
            qnext = 0;
#if 0
            printf("switch queue, new dist %d, queue %d\n", currdist, qhead);
#endif
        } else if (remaining == 0 && qnext == 0) {
            break;
        } else {
            int pos = scratch->queue[qcurr][qtail++];
            int y = pos / w;
            int x = pos % w;
#if 0
            printf("checking neighbours of %d,%d\n", x, y);
#endif
            int dir;
            for (dir = 0; dir < 4; dir++) {
                int y1 = y + (dir == 1 ? 1 : dir == 3 ? -1 : 0);
                int x1 = x + (dir == 0 ? 1 : dir == 2 ? -1 : 0);
                if (0 <= x1 && x1 < w && 0 <= y1 && y1 < h) {
                    int pos1 = y1*w+x1;
#if 0
                    printf("trying %d,%d: colours %d-%d dist %d\n", x1, y1,
                           grid[pos], grid[pos1], scratch->dist[pos]);
#endif
                    if (scratch->dist[pos1] == -1 &&
                        ((grid[pos1] == grid[pos] &&
                          scratch->dist[pos] == currdist) ||
                         (grid[pos1] != grid[pos] &&
                          scratch->dist[pos] == currdist - 1))) {
#if 0
                        printf("marking %d,%d dist %d\n", x1, y1, currdist);
#endif
                        scratch->queue[qcurr][qhead++] = pos1;
                        scratch->queue[qcurr^1][qnext++] = pos1;
                        scratch->dist[pos1] = currdist;
                        remaining--;
                    }
                }
            }
        }
    }

    *rdist = currdist;
    *rnumber = qhead;
    if (currdist == 0)
        *rcontrol = qhead;
}

/*
 * Try out every possible move on a grid, and choose whichever one
 * reduced the result of search() by the most.
 */
static char choosemove_recurse(int w, int h, char *grid, int x0, int y0,
                               int maxmove, struct solver_scratch *scratch,
                               int depth, int *rbestdist, int *rbestnumber, int *rbestcontrol)
{
    int wh = w*h;
    char move, bestmove;
    int dist, number, control, bestdist, bestnumber, bestcontrol;
    char *tmpgrid;

    assert(0 <= depth && depth < RECURSION_DEPTH);
    tmpgrid = scratch->rgrids + depth*wh;

    bestdist = wh + 1;
    bestnumber = 0;
    bestcontrol = 0;
    bestmove = -1;

#if 0
    dump_grid(w, h, grid, "before choosemove_recurse %d", depth);
#endif
    for (move = 0; move < maxmove; move++) {
        if (grid[y0*w+x0] == move)
            continue;
        memcpy(tmpgrid, grid, wh * sizeof(*grid));
        fill(w, h, tmpgrid, x0, y0, move, scratch->queue[0]);
        if (completed(w, h, tmpgrid)) {
            /*
             * A move that wins is immediately the best, so stop
             * searching. Record what depth of recursion that happened
             * at, so that higher levels will choose a move that gets
             * to a winning position sooner.
             */
            *rbestdist = -1;
            *rbestnumber = depth;
            *rbestcontrol = wh;
            return move;
        }
        if (depth < RECURSION_DEPTH-1) {
            choosemove_recurse(w, h, tmpgrid, x0, y0, maxmove, scratch,
                               depth+1, &dist, &number, &control);
        } else {
#if 0
            dump_grid(w, h, tmpgrid, "after move %d at depth %d",
                      move, depth);
#endif
            search(w, h, tmpgrid, x0, y0, scratch, &dist, &number, &control);
#if 0
            dump_dist(w, h, scratch->dist, "after move %d at depth %d",
                      move, depth);
            printf("move %d at depth %d: %d at %d\n",
                   depth, move, number, dist);
#endif
        }
        if (dist < bestdist ||
            (dist == bestdist &&
             (number < bestnumber ||
              (number == bestnumber &&
               (control > bestcontrol))))) {
            bestdist = dist;
            bestnumber = number;
            bestcontrol = control;
            bestmove = move;
        }
    }
#if 0
    printf("best at depth %d was %d (%d at %d, %d controlled)\n",
           depth, bestmove, bestnumber, bestdist, bestcontrol);
#endif

    *rbestdist = bestdist;
    *rbestnumber = bestnumber;
    *rbestcontrol = bestcontrol;
    return bestmove;
}

static char *new_game_desc(const game_params *params, random_state *rs,
			   char **aux, bool interactive)
{
    int w = params->w, h = params->h, wh = w*h;
    int i, moves;
    char *desc;
    struct solver_scratch *scratch;

    scratch = new_scratch(w, h);

    /*
     * Invent a random grid.
     */
    do {
        for (i = 0; i < wh; i++)
            scratch->grid[i] = random_upto(rs, params->colours);
    } while (completed(w, h, scratch->grid));

    /*
     * Run the solver, and count how many moves it uses.
     */
    memcpy(scratch->grid2, scratch->grid, wh * sizeof(*scratch->grid2));
    moves = 0;
    check_recursion_depth();
    while (!completed(w, h, scratch->grid2)) {
        char move = choosemove(w, h, scratch->grid2, FILLX, FILLY,
                               params->colours, scratch);
        fill(w, h, scratch->grid2, FILLX, FILLY, move, scratch->queue[0]);
        moves++;
    }

    /*
     * Adjust for difficulty.
     */
    moves += params->leniency;

    /*
     * Encode the game id.
     */
    desc = snewn(wh + 40, char);
    for (i = 0; i < wh; i++) {
        char colour = scratch->grid[i];
        char textcolour = (colour > 9 ? 'A' : '0') + colour;
        desc[i] = textcolour;
    }
    sprintf(desc+i, ",%d", moves);

    free_scratch(scratch);

    return desc;
}
